Transaction 86fe5692ad595d588dfe44c703f22066369375391d523367e5de43df57295a8a
1 Input
1 Output
-
86fe5692ad595d588dfe44c703f22066369375391d523367e5de43df57295a8a:0
- value
- 3046320
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ade4bd210bbad8fe9a9236ed59445dc9c027e91
- address
- bc1qnt0yh5sshwkcl6dfydhdt9z9mjwqyl538y25ud